SINGAPORE Airlines (SIA) has finalised a US$13.8 billion order for 39 Boeing aircraft in an agreement that was first announced in February this year.
On Tuesday, the airline said in a Singapore Exchange filing that a firm order with Boeing for 20 777-9s and 19 787-10s was formally signed for "additional growth and fleet modernisation through the next decade".
